Amos 1 is the first chapter of the Book of Amos in the Hebrew Bible or the Old Testament of the Christian Bible.[1][2] This book contains the prophecies attributed to the prophet Amos, and is a part of the Book of the Twelve Minor Prophets.[3][4] This chapter contains prophecies of God's judgments on Israel's neighbours, Syria, Philistia, Tyre, Edom, and Ammon.[5] Judgments on Moab, and on Israel itself, follow in chapter 2.
